I would NOT pull any of those boats with less than a 3/4 ton vehicle.

And, just because it says 3/4 ton doesn't mean it's up to the task. You still have to make sure you have the right engine/trans/rear combo. Last, don't forget to make sure the hitch is rated to tow what you are towing, too. A hitch can say it can tow 10k lbs, but only if it is a "weight distributing" setup, which most boat trailers can't have. So really, then, you need a class IV or V to tow 10k+ lbs.
